#06f769 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#06f769 is composed of 2.4% red, 96.9%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 57.5%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 144.6 degrees, a saturation of 95.3% and a lightness of 49.6%. #06f769 color hex could be obtained by blending #0cffd2 with #00ef00. Closest websafe color is: #00ff66.

#06f769 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#06f769 has RGB values of R:6, G:247, B:105 and CMYK values of C:0.98, M:0, Y:0.57,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 456553.
